@ Anon; the referees wanted the bench to reset the clock to 0.4 seconds for the final NZ possession, but despite numerous attempts to stop the clock manually at that time, the closest they could get was 0.5. That was a technology issue though.
Then the Breakers ran a "trick" inbounds play which involved another player stepping out of bounds to take the inbounds pass from the initial inbounder, but the bench started the clock when this pass happened despite the ball not entering play.
